<p>Anyway, Saturday wasn&#8217;t much of a birthday but I made reservations at a phenomenal restaurant for Sunday night.&nbsp; It&#8217;s a Tapas restaurant in downtown Philly called <a href="http://www.amadarestaurant.com/">Amada</a>.&nbsp; &nbsp;I&nbsp; had to call 5 days in advance to get reservations at a decent time, it&#8217;s that rockin.&nbsp; We got there last night at 9pm and had one of our top dining experiences ever, seriously.&nbsp; </p>
<p>The selection was amazing, the presentation was impeccable and the flavors were out of this world.&nbsp; If you&#8217;re not familiar with <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Tapas">tapas</a>, they are kind of &quot;mini-meals&quot; that are traditional spanish fare.&nbsp; Typically you combine several and share them to create a full meal, but made up of lots of smaller dishes.&nbsp; Here&#8217;s what I love about tapas; the chef&#8217;s full attention goes into that one dish, then the next, then the next.&nbsp; It&#8217;s not this big heaping thing of pasta that you fill up on or get tired of halfway through.&nbsp; Every bite you take has been meticulously crafted to be the best bite it can be.&nbsp; </p>
